Splitting cells
Select the column of data and then click DATA in the menu, select TEXT TO
COLUMNS. You'll want to make sure that there are enough blank columns to the right of the source data to accommodate the parsed data. -- Kevin Backmann "Splitting one cell into multiple cells" wrote: Is there a way in Excel to split a cell into multiple cells? |
